Abstract

Un método para cuantificar los ingredientes de una pluma, porque comprende los pasos de dirigir un barrido de un haz de Iuz a través de Ia pluma hacia una superficie sobre Ia cual el haz de Iuz es dispersado; adquirir Ia luz dispersa, diseminada desde la superficie; y procesar Ia Iuz dispersa adquirida, para determinar Ia cantidad de ingredientes de Ia pluma; y dispositivo asociado.
